The California Air Resources Board today approved a statewide plan for attaining the federal health-based standard for ozone, typically experienced as smog. The 2022 State Implementation Plan Strategy identifies the state’s control strategy for meeting the federal 70 parts per billion, 8-hour ozone standard over the next 15 years.

The transportation sector was responsible for over 7 million tons of NO x emissions in the US in 2014, with 50% of this sector’s NO x attributed to heavy-duty on- and off-road vehicles and equipment. NO x is a precursor for both ground level ozone and secondary PM 2.5 Source of data: US EPA (2019). Chart: MECA.

A study led by researchers at UC Berkeley has found that diesel exhaust forms about seven times more secondary organic aerosols (SOA) than gasoline exhaust for the same mass of unburned fuel emissions and, given emission factors, can be expected to form 15 times more SOA than gasoline per liter of fuel burned.

At cruising altitude, airplanes emit a steady stream of NO x into the atmosphere, where the chemicals can linger to produce ozone and fine particulates. issued its final rule revising the National Ambient Air Quality Standards (NAAQS) for ground-level ozone to 70 parts per billion (ppb) from 75 ppb to protect public health. Ground-level ozone forms when nitrogen oxides (NO x ) and volatile organic compounds (VOCs) react in the air. The US Environmental Protection Agency (EPA).
